Cheesecake made in Holland, an extraordinary CBD flower, characterized by organoelectric elements that distinguish it from all the other Cannabis Light varieties currently on the market in Europe.
The production of trichomes and resin present on this plant are clearly visible even to the naked eye, the aroma of these flowers is reminiscent of wild berries and seasoned spicy cheese. There are ten weeks of flowering before we can harvest this amazing inflorescence.

The Cheese strain is reportedly a phenotype of Skunk #1, a strain created by Sam “The Skunkman,” who brought it over from California to the Netherlands. From there, the Indica-dominant Cheese was bred and given notoriety in the United Kingdom in the late 1980s. Given the name “Cheese” as a signifier of its strong, cheddar-like flavor and aroma, the clone-only female is reported to have been crossed with Indica strains by several underground UK breeders for the proliferation of Cheese seeds.
